The Faber Castell FC167137 Wallet Pitt Pen Nibs Art Set features 8 black pigmented India ink pens with a range of nib sizes, including exclusive extra soft brush and needle tips. The archival, acid-free, and pH neutral ink is waterproof and smudge-proof when dry, ensuring long-lasting, vibrant artwork. Designed for portability, the convenient wallet keeps all pens organized, making it ideal for artists on the move.

It's all there in black and white...
I've been using copic drawing pens, and micron before that, and was hesitant to switch again. I've only had one drawing session with this pen set, but i LIKE the feel of these pens. At first i thought the ink a little too gray for me, but as I drew with it I found I really like it. The ink flows smoothly and easily, and I love the variety of tips. Nice selection! For broad lines, I thought the B would be my go-to pen, but I found I liked the SC best, even going over some of my B lines to change them. The XS is quite fine enough for my purposes, although copic and micron offer finer tips than this. (This company may as well, just not in this set?) I love that they've included a narrower and shorter tipped brush pen... Hooray!! I'll definitely use that. Using one of the larger tips (the SC, I believe) I did have one small smear where my hand dragged across it too soon, but I didnt have that problem with any of the other sizes. Or with that pen again, once I was paying better attention. Another reviewer had said they could do a light watercolor wash over the ink without it running or bleeding, but I dont know yet. I'll update this review once I try this, and also if I find the pens dry out quickly. If you like a looser, more markery feel, give these a try! update january 2016: I've done several large projects with these (see photos for two) and still love them. The smallest nib, xs, has worn out. The felt part is damaged nowAND I'm out of ink, I think. I feel like I did a lot with it, but I'm going to test a few other brands and see if they hold up differently. I am very happy with my results, though. Great pens!

Smooth but wear easily
Teacher required these for an art class and I'm on my 3rd already. To be fair, there's a lot of work for this class! The pens do seem to have a superior softness and ability to write from any angle so you can "ghost" lines by holding the pen at an angle, which not all fine pointed pens will do (my teacher keeps saying there aren't fine liners, they're artist pens and artist pens are better!). But the nib does wear down and it loses that ability. I still have ink in the ones I set aside, so I'm going to use them for other things, but the nib wore out and isn't versatile enough for sketching anymore The above applies to sizes S and XS. I only needed those for art class and have worn through them. I bought the multipack just for fun and really love how soft and easy to use the B, SB and SC are It's a great set, just know if you're using it for art the soft artist nib is useful for sketching but will wear out faster than fine liners meant for drafting

Great Variety of Pens!
I love these markers! They do write a little bit more gray than black, however I don't mind this. The B, SC, and SB pens are more like markers and are somewhat flimsy, which makes controlling or writing with them difficult, but I assume their purpose is not for writing and they are more suited for something that requires less precision and broader strokes. The 1,5 pen is the boldest sturdy pen that they provide, and the other smaller pens work wonderfully as well. The ink flows smoothly and I am very excited to use these! This is a great purchase for someone looking for a variety of different pens.
